  11. God had a Plan • Fulfilled prophecies from 100s of years before • Time of Jesus’ death, 3 pm • Also the year Jesus died • Saturday, the Sabbath, was the Feast of Unleavened Bread • Sunday was the Feast of Firstfruits

  12. Joseph’s Tomb • It was new/unused (Lk 23:53) • Worth a year’s wages • Pharisaic law would have prohibited Joseph from using it for his own family now • It was intended for Joseph’s family • A HUGE sacrifice

  13. Temple Curtain • Day of Atonement • High Priest went behind the curtain (Lev 16:29-34 & Heb 9:7) • Jesus’ blood made the curtain, the High Priest, and the Holy of Holies moot • Now every believer has direct access to God

  14. The Cup • Jewish marriage custom • Bridegroom symbolically offers his life in a cup of wine to the bride • By accepting the cup, the bride indicates her lifelong commitment to the bridegroom • Jesus calls Himself the bridegroom (Mk 2: 18-19) • Who is the bride? Rev 19:6-9

  15. The Cup • Jewish Passover custom • They used 4 cups of wine • 3rd was the cup of salvation • That was what Jesus used in the accounts of the Last Supper • The new covenant in My blood
